All Cast

Sun Honglei

Sun Honglei

Zhang Qiang

Gong Li

Gong Li

Zhou Yu / Xiu

Tony Leung Ka-fai

Tony Leung Ka-fai

Chen Qing

Zhang Heng

Zhang Heng

Sun Zhou

Sun Zhou